Ind vs NZ – Rohit Sharma, Shubman Gill, Shreyas Iyer and Mohammed Shami spill chances in Champions Trophy final

India was far from their best on the field after their invitation to Bowl by New Zealand during the Champions Trophy final in Dubai. The two chances did not cost India, because Ravira was turned upside down by the first delivery of Kuldeep Yadav at the beginning of 11 for 37. But the Miss continued to come.

The chance of Phillips did not cost much to India much either. He was 27 years old when Gill deposited him and he left shortly after 34 years, Foxled by Varun Chakravarthy on Googly. Mitchell, however, was half a century – he had been abandoned at 40 – and was finally dismissed for 63 in the 46th by Shami.

New Zealand, in the second half, also deposited a few chances, although the first was undoubtedly the most difficult chance that took place in the game. The last, however, was the simplest.

Iyer was on 44 when he was abandoned. He added only four more points before being dismissed. Gill, too, failed to take his life in a major way, he was 6 years old when he was abandoned and finally dropped for 31.
